Joslin Diabetes Center
Joslin Diabetes Center is a globally renowned diabetes research center, clinic, and education facility dedicated to the fight against diabetes. Founded in 1898 by Elliott P. Joslin, the center is based in Boston, Massachusetts, and is affiliated with Harvard Medical School. It is recognized for its comprehensive care approach, innovative research, and dedication to finding a cure for diabetes and improving the lives of people affected by the disease.
History
The Joslin Diabetes Center was established by Dr. Elliott P. Joslin, who was among the first doctors in the United States to specialize in diabetes and is considered a pioneer in the field. Dr. Joslin was a proponent of the idea that education and self-management are crucial in treating diabetes, a philosophy that remains central to the center's mission today.
Mission and Vision
The mission of the Joslin Diabetes Center is to prevent, treat, and cure diabetes. Its vision encompasses a world free of diabetes and its complications. The center achieves its mission through cutting-edge research, comprehensive patient care, and education programs for both patients and healthcare professionals.
Research
Joslin Diabetes Center is at the forefront of diabetes research, focusing on understanding the biological mechanisms of diabetes, developing new treatments, and ultimately finding a cure. The center's research efforts are divided into various programs and departments, including genetics, cell biology, regenerative medicine, and clinical research. Joslin researchers are also working on the development of artificial pancreas technology and stem cell therapy for diabetes.
Clinical Care
The clinical care at Joslin Diabetes Center is focused on providing patients with personalized treatment plans that address the physical, psychological, and educational aspects of diabetes. The center offers services for adults and children with type 1 and type 2 diabetes, as well as for those with gestational diabetes and diabetes-related complications. The multidisciplinary team includes endocrinologists, diabetes educators, nutritionists, and exercise physiologists.
Education
Education is a cornerstone of the Joslin Diabetes Center's approach to diabetes management. The center offers a wide range of educational programs for patients, including diabetes self-management education, nutritional counseling, and exercise guidance. Additionally, Joslin provides professional education for healthcare providers to ensure they are equipped with the latest knowledge and tools to effectively treat diabetes.
Affiliations
Joslin Diabetes Center is affiliated with Harvard Medical School, which enhances its research capabilities and educational outreach. Through this affiliation, Joslin participates in collaborative research projects and provides clinical training for medical students and residents.
Facilities
The main facility of the Joslin Diabetes Center is located in Boston, Massachusetts. It houses state-of-the-art laboratories for research, comprehensive clinical care facilities, and educational spaces for patients and professionals. Joslin also operates satellite clinics and affiliates across the United States to extend its reach and impact.
